About Us:

WEHR Constructors, Inc. has been a trusted name in providing communities with safe, functional, and aesthetically pleasing environments since 1945. As one of the leading construction management firms in Kentucky and Florida, we pride ourselves on our commitment to excellence. Our headquarters is located in Louisville, Kentucky, with additional offices in Lexington, Bowling Green, and Tampa.

What We Are Seeking:

We are looking for a dedicated professional with a strong passion for recruitment and a minimum of 2-4 years of experience to join our HR Team. This role will involve managing the recruitment and onboarding processes for our organization while supporting various business units in their staffing needs.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Continuously assess and refine WEHR's sourcing strategies, metrics development, and daily management of recruitment and onboarding activities.
  • Collaborate with Hiring Managers and Directors to create staffing plans aligned with business requirements.
  • Act as the primary liaison for candidates throughout the entire recruitment process.
  • Oversee the onboarding and offboarding processes for all new hires, including conducting check-ins at 30, 60, and 90 days.
  • Evaluate talent acquisition processes and data to enhance diversity in our candidate pool and workforce.
  • Plan and execute community outreach initiatives to cultivate talent pipelines and build relationships with community leaders.
  • Ensure job descriptions and postings convey a consistent message to attract potential candidates.
  • Provide guidance and support on recruitment structure, hiring practices, and onboarding procedures.
  • Manage online recruitment platforms and applicant tracking systems.
  • Stay informed about recruiting resources to recommend innovative methods for attracting qualified candidates.
  • Deliver ongoing Key Performance Indicator (KPI) metrics to management, including openings and time-to-fill statistics.
  • Organize and participate in on-site recruitment events at local educational institutions as necessary.
  • Collaborate with vendors such as LinkedIn and Indeed to integrate their services into our recruitment strategy.
  • Facilitate the hiring process, ensuring a positive candidate experience, which includes resume reviews, phone interviews, background checks, and onboarding activities.
  • Perform additional duties as assigned.
Qualifications:
  • Bachelor's Degree in Human Resources, Business, or a related field preferred, or equivalent work experience required.
  • 2-4 years of experience in recruiting and sourcing across various organizational levels.
  • SHRM-CP or SHRM-SCP certification preferred.
  • SHRM's Talent Acquisition Specialty Credential, or a willingness to obtain it, is a plus.
  • Experience in the construction industry is advantageous but not mandatory.
